Полоса пользовательская кнопка - PullRequest
0 голосов
/ 28 ноября 2018

, поэтому я пытаюсь интегрировать кнопку проверки полосы (бета-версия, которая приводит вас на страницу проверки полосы), проблема в том, что кнопка является серой и простой и не смогла изменить размер или цвет или отформатировать ее в целом.

У меня нет никаких навыков кодирования, я пытался использовать пользовательскую кнопку CSS, но не уверен, как я могу связать это с исходным кодом.

Поэтому я ценю, если кто-нибудь может помочьмне либо:

Иметь возможность связать результат нажатия кнопки оригинальной полосы с одной из моих кнопок ИЛИ

Помогите отформатировать кнопку, увеличив ее размер, используя определенныйшрифт и выбор цвета, чтобы я мог изменить их самостоятельно.

Заранее большое спасибо

Это код, который я использую:

<!-- Load Stripe.js on your website. -->
<script src="https://js.stripe.com/v3"></script>

<!-- Create a button that your customers click to complete their purchase. -->
<button id="checkout-button">StandardBlue</button>
<div id="error-message"></div>

<script>
  var stripe = Stripe('KEYYYYYYYYYYYYYYYYYYYYYYYYYYYY', {
    betas: ['checkout_beta_3']
  });

  var checkoutButton = document.getElementById('checkout-button');
  checkoutButton.addEventListener('click', function () {
    // When the customer clicks on the button, redirect
    // them to Checkout.
    stripe.redirectToCheckout({
      items: [{sku: 'SKU', quantity: 1}],
      successUrl: 'https://WEBSITE.COM/success',
      cancelUrl: 'https://WEBSITE.COM/canceled',
    })
    .then(function (result) {
      if (result.error) {
        // If `redirectToCheckout` fails due to a browser or network
        // error, display the localized error message to your customer.
        var displayError = document.getElementById('error-message');
        displayError.textContent = result.error.message;
      }
    });
  });
</script>

1 Ответ

0 голосов
/ 30 ноября 2018

Довольно просто здесь.Просто добавьте css с кнопкой выбора # checkout.

Вот пример: https://jsfiddle.net/tonyprovenzola/sb7dtakz/3/

button#checkout-button {
font-family:'Arial', sans-serif;
padding:10px 14px;
background-color:#255eba;
border-radius:10px;
color:#fff;
cursor:pointer;
border:none;
outline:none;
}

button#checkout-button:hover {
background-color:#112a51;
}
...